No holiday for State Senate

ALBANY - Gov. David A. Paterson Wednesday delivered on his threat to convene the State Senate over Independence Day weekend after only one side in the stalemate showed up for public talks.

Paterson ordered special sessions Thursday though Monday. He also called for senators to hammer out an extended "power-sharing" agreement similar to ones that broke ties in Oklahoma, New Jersey and Maine....
